Terrorists kill RAB officer in Chattogram
A RAB officer was killed and three other personnel seriously injured when conducting a drive to arrest a criminal in Jungle Salimpur area in Chattogram on Monday evening.
RAB-7 Deputy Assistant Director Abdul Motaleb was killed after terrorists attacked his team with firearms and other weapons.
Md Ahsan Habib Palash, deputy inspector general of police at Chattogram Range confirmed this to reporters at 8:00 pm.
According to police, two vehicles of the RAB Patenga battalion entered the terror-infested area in the evening to detain a criminal. At one point, a group of terrorists attacked the convoy. Afterwards, the criminals took Motaleb and his compatriots as hostages.
Later, a team from the Sitakunda Police Station rescued the hostages and sent them to the Combined Military Hospital (CMH) in Chattogram Cantonment, where the doctors declared Motaleb dead. RAB and police presence has been beefed up in the area.
According to local sources, a BNP office was inaugurated in the area before the gunfight between RAB and the terrorists. However, it could not be confirmed whether the Rokon force or the Yasin force was behind the attack.
When asked about this, North District Jubo Dal Joint General Secretary Rokon Uddin Member denied the allegations of involvement in the incident and said, "We are not involved in this incident. We have come to know about it from the administration."
Jungle Salimpur is located two kilometres west of Bayezid Bostami in Chattogram city, opposite Asian Women University, on the northern side of Link Road.
The 3,100-acre Jungle Salimpur area, located in Salimpur union of Sitakunda upazila, is designated as a government land. Although it is in Sitakunda, it is largely inside the city. To the east lies Hathazari upazila and to the south, Bayezid police station.
The area has been almost entirely controlled by groups of terrorists, hill cutters and land grabbers for more than three decades.
Residents require ID cards to enter; outsiders cannot enter. Outsider's entry is virtually impossible. Even police and district administration personnel have been attacked multiple times while trying to enter.
Due to its remote hilly terrain, the area has become a safe haven for terrorists. Since 5 August last year, following changes in national politics, the area has witnessed clashes and killings over control.
Behind this criminal empire; there are two influential parties—the ‘Alinagar Bahumukhi Samiti’ led by identified terrorist Yasin Mia and the ‘Mahanagar Chinnamoool Bastibasi Sangram Parishad’, controlled by Kazi Mashiur and Gazi Sadek. The administration estimates that the membership of the two organizations is around 30,000.
Recently, gunfights erupted between two factions of terrorists over territory, resulting in one death. The next day, two journalists were attacked while preparing a report there.
On 14 September 2023, while returning from clearing illegal settlements in Chhinnamul Boroitola 2, at least 20 officials, including the then Executive Magistrate Md Umar Faruk and Sitakunda police officer-in-charge (OC) Tofail Ahmed, were injured in an attack. Residents of the area also threw crude bombs and bricks at administration officials, and police fired shots to control the situation.
